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about preschools in Carnation, WA:

What are the typical costs for preschool programs in Carnation, WA?

In Carnation, monthly tuition for part-time preschool programs typically ranges from $300 to $600, while full-time care can cost $1,200 to $1,800. Costs vary based on program type (co-op, private, or faith-based), hours, and whether the school participates in the Washington State Department of Children, Youth, and Families (DCYF) subsidy program for eligible families.

How do I verify the quality and licensing of a preschool in Carnation?

All licensed childcare and preschool programs in Carnation must be licensed by Washington State DCYF. You can use the DCYF childcare search tool to view a provider's license status, inspection reports, and any compliance history. Additionally, many local preschools may pursue accreditation from organizations like NAEYC, which indicates a higher standard of quality.

Are there any nature or outdoor-focused preschool options in the Carnation area?

Yes, the Carnation area is known for its strong emphasis on outdoor education. Several local preschools incorporate forest school principles, utilizing the nearby Snoqualmie Valley trails, farms, and the Tolt River as outdoor classrooms. It's recommended to inquire directly with programs about their daily outdoor time and philosophy.

What is the enrollment timeline and process like for Carnation preschools?

Many popular preschools in Carnation begin their enrollment periods in January or February for the following fall semester, with some offering open houses in the preceding winter. Due to limited slots, early inquiry and application are advised. Some programs, especially co-ops, may have waitlists, so contacting schools 6-12 months in advance is a common local recommendation.

Given Carnation's semi-rural location, what should I consider regarding preschool schedules and transportation?

Most preschools in Carnation do not provide transportation, so parents must factor in commute time. Program schedules often align with the Riverview School District calendar but may offer more flexible hours than urban centers. It's important to confirm operating hours, early release days, and closure policies, as options for extended care can be more limited locally.

Finding Your Village: Navigating Early Childhood Education in Carnation

For parents in Carnation, the search for the right early childhood setting can feel both exciting and overwhelming. You’re not just looking for a "top daycare near me"; you’re seeking a nurturing extension of your family, a place where your child’s curiosity is sparked and their social foundations are gently built. Our tight-knit community offers a wonderful advantage in this search, where personalized care and connection are often at the heart of our local options.

The journey begins by defining what "top" means for your family. For some, it’s a program with a structured curriculum that prepares little ones for kindergarten, perhaps with a focus on outdoor exploration that leverages our beautiful Snoqualmie Valley surroundings. For others, a top choice is a smaller, home-based setting that offers a cozy, family-like atmosphere. Carnation is fortunate to have a mix of both, from licensed family home providers to more structured preschool programs. The key is to align the environment with your child’s temperament and your family’s values.

We recommend starting your search with more than an online list. Talk to other parents at the library, the park, or the farmers market. Personal referrals in a community like ours are invaluable. Once you have a few names, the real work begins with visits. Don’t just schedule one; if possible, pop in unexpectedly to get a genuine feel for the daily rhythm. Look for engaged, happy children and teachers who are on the floor interacting, not just supervising. In Carnation, many top providers emphasize outdoor time, rain or shine, so notice if there are safe, interesting outdoor spaces for muddy boots and imaginative play.

Ask specific questions about daily schedules, teacher qualifications and longevity, and their philosophy on discipline and learning. How do they handle conflicts between toddlers? What does a typical day look like? Inquire about communication; a top provider will have an open-door policy for parents and regular updates about your child’s day and development. Also, be sure to verify their Washington State Department of Children, Youth, and Families (DCYF) license is current and check their compliance history online—it’s a crucial step for peace of mind.

Remember, the "best" program is the one that feels right. Trust your instincts as a parent. Does the space feel warm and inviting? Do you feel a sense of trust and partnership with the director or caregiver? This connection is paramount.
